Project Architect / Owner’s Representative – Project Management Firm
Job Description
A San Antonio-based project management firm is seeking an experienced Project Architect / Owner’s Representative to manage projects during design and construction administration phases.
This role serves as a key representative of the project owner during design and construction, ensuring quality control, schedule compliance, and successful project closeout through the warranty period. The position is pre-construction and construction phase services as an owner's representative. The firm does not provide design services of any sort and doesn't construct buildings.
This position does not require architectural licensure.
Duties and Responsibilities
- Act as owner’s representative during design and construction through warranty period.
- Participate in managing and supporting facility assessments, programming, and pre-construction planning.
- Support working with building commissioning and building envelope commissioning activities.
- Oversee and coordinate RFIs, submittals, shop drawings, change orders, and pay applications.
- Conduct and/or manage site observations and quality assurance/quality control (QA/QC) reviews.
- Monitor project schedules, milestones, and contractor performance.
- Ensure successful project closeout, including O&M manuals and documentation turnover.
- Coordinate communication between owners, contractors, and design/construction teams.
- Identify and resolve field issues to maintain project quality, budget, and schedule.
